Facility Inspections

Grade: A-plus

On top of being a strong facility overall, it also received A+ health inspections in recent years. Its inspections were nearly perfect. Inspection scores take several factors into consideration, including deficiencies and federal fines. You can learn more about each of these factors by reviewing copies of nursing homes' inspection reports. While this place had a few deficiencies on its report, none of them were serious based on CMS' deficiency scale. Finally, this facility had no substantiated complaints this year from residents, which is an excellent sign.

Long-term Care Quality

Grade: A-minus

One of the other reasons we rated this facility so highly is that it was given a dominant long-term care grade. In fact, long-term care ended up being its second most impressive category grade. In that area, we awarded this facility a score of A-. Long-term care ratings in this range generally require both 24/7 care from nurses and aids, as well as quality routine healthcare services. On top of assessing the quantity of care provided by nurses aids and other staff, we also looked at the percentage of residents vaccinated for pneumonia. This facility administered the vaccine to 100 percent of its residents, which is very impressive. Pneumonia is too frequently a deadly condition for nursing home residents so we like it when a facility doesn't roll the dice on this issue. Finally, this place was able to limit hospitalizations. Indeed, it had only 0.02 hospitalizations per 1,000 long-term resident days, which is an impressively low number.

Short-term Care Quality

Grade: A-minus

This facility really excelled in the category of short-term care, where we awarded it a score of A-. Only a select group of nursing homes performed more favorably in this area. Our short-term care scores are vital for prospective residents requiring rehabilitation. Rehabilitation typically mandates more highly-skilled nursing. Skilled nursing includes a broad scope of nursing services, spanning from registered nurses to physical and speech therapists, as well as other types of therapy. Fortunately, it appear that this nursing home employs registered nurses. Not every facility employs these types of nurses. On the other hand, based on the information they provided, it does not look like the facility employs physical therapists. The final datapoint we looked at in this area is the number of patients who were able to leave the nursing home and return to the community. We found that 5.8 percent of this nursing home's residents returned home.

Nurse Quality

Grade: C

Switching gears to the last area, this facility received a respectable nursing rating. Although this was not as strong as many of its other scores, this is truly not a poor grade. We looked at the qualifications of nurses at the facility, as well as the number of hours those nurses spent with residents, in determining our grade in this category. This place provides only 0.3 hours of nursing care per resident on a daily basis. This is a somewhat alarming figure which is well below average. Finally, our nursing ratings also factor in some quality-focused metrics. We look at the percentage of patients who suffered pressure ulcers and major falls. These statistics are measures of the quality of nursing care, since superior care tends to reduce these problems.

Care One at Hanover Township Quality Metrics

Minimizes Pressure Ulcers

Grade: B

In Care One at Hanover Township, 7.34% of Patients had Pressure Ulcers

This statistic indicates the percent of long-term residents who developed new or worsened pressure ulcers. We find that pressure ulcers are a solid barometer of the quality of nursing care a facility provides.

Minimizes Serious Falls

Grade: B-minus

In Care One at Hanover Township, 4.14% of Patients had Serious Falls

This tells you the percent of patients who sustained a major fall. Falls resulting in major injuries are considered by many in the nursing home industry to be a measure of the quality of nursing care at a nursing home. Falls resulting in injury are often the result of lower levels of patient supervision.

Minimizes Urinary Tract Infections

Grade: A+

In Care One at Hanover Township, 0% of Patients had UTIs

This is the percent of residents that suffered from a urinary tract infection. These infections are linked to poorer hygiene.

Appropriately Uses Anti-Psychotic Medication

Grade: B-minus

In Care One at Hanover Township, 17.19% of Patients use Anti-Psychotic Medication

This indicates the percentage of patients who were prescribed antipsychotic drugs. While antipsychotic medications may be helpful for many patients, it is important to confirm these medications are being used appropriately. In limited cases, excessive reliance on these medications may mean a nursing home is using these medications to control patient behavior.

Appropriately Uses Anti-Anxiety Medication

Grade: A-minus

In Care One at Hanover Township, 13.77% of Patients use Anti-Anxiety Medication

This is the percent of residents who were given antianxiety medications. Antianxiety medications are prescribed to residents experiencing depression and anxiety.

Managing Depression Among Residents

Grade: D

In Care One at Hanover Township, 20% of Patients

This indicates the percentage of patients who are showing depressive symptoms. Higher rates of depression could be a sign lower quality care.

Appropriate Vaccine Usage

Grade: B-plus

In Care One at Hanover Township, 97.97% of Patients

This tells you the percent of patients that were administered the pneumonia and flu vaccines. High vaccination rates should be the norm at this point.

Residents Maintain Autonomy

Grade: C

In Care One at Hanover Township, 18.32% of Patients

This is the percentage of patients who required increased assistance with activities of daily living over time. Higher levels of needing for assistance with ADL's could indicate deterioration of a patient's medical condition.

Ability to Keep Residents Mobile

Grade: A-minus

In Care One at Hanover Township, 21.82% of Residents

This is a measure of the percentage of long-term patients that maintained mobility. Many in the industry argue that the ability to move around is critical to patients physical and mental well-being.

Hospitalizations

Grade: A-minus

In Care One at Hanover Township, 0.02 Hospitalizations per 1,000 resident days

This indicates the number of times residents are hospitalized per thousand days of patient care.

Short-term Care: Rehospitalizations

Grade: C

In Care One at Hanover Township, 21.82% of Residents Rehospitalized

This metric is a measure of the number of rehospitalizations per thousand days of short-term resident care. Avoiding rehospitalizations during rehabilitation is critical to restoring the health of patients.

Short-term Care: ER Visits

Grade: A-minus

In Care One at Hanover Township, 8.47% of Patients

Measures the number of emergency room visits per thousand days of short-term care. Avoiding emergency medical situations is one way to measure short-term care.

Short-term Care: Facilitates Functional Improvement

Grade: B-plus

In Care One at Hanover Township, 82% of Resident

This is the percentage of short-term care patients who experienced functional improvements, such as enhanced ability to perform activities of daily living.
